Ashworth Creative – Job Opening: We Are Hiring – Front End Developer!
Ashworth Creative is looking for a full-time, detail oriented, Front End Developer with an eye for design. We are a fast-paced, growing, boutique marketing agency located in New York’s Hudson Valley. Come join our team of smart, flexible, self-motivated and creative thinkers who serve clients from many different industries and from around the world. You’ll report to the Creative Director and work alongside other developers, project managers, content creators, designers and a video production team. This is not a remote position. Our office is located in the Poughkeepsie Journal Building a few blocks away from the Poughkeepsie train station, top notch restaurants and the Walkway Over the Hudson.
We believe a Front End Developer’s main goal is to combine technology and design to create inviting, impactful, and easy-to-use websites for clients and consumers. Information architecture, intelligent site mapping (Slickplan for preference) and organization of content are all vital elements in our process and should be in your skillset, too. Take a look at our website, it’s built on WordPress, and you’ll see how we integrate excellent design with successful user journeys that meet the needs of all site visitors.
You would be responsible for using your knowledge of programming languages to build and code user-side applications, including visual elements like menus, clickable buttons and the overall layout of websites or web applications. Duties include communicating with clients to identify their needs, optimizing websites for different devices and running tests to check for speed, performance, ADA compliance, and browser compatibility.
Apply for this job if you are a good communicator, able to speak to and write clearly and persuasively on behalf of our clients and Ashworth Creative. Ability to establish and follow production schedules, to deliver strong conceptual ideas, follow through with research, documentation, development and design are all essential skills for the job. Proficiency with WordPress, Shopify, and Wix are a must. Other CMS platforms are a plus. We know the kind of agile and organized individual that we need is out there and we’re excited to meet you!
